#3 pwdst

Looking on the RS Components website it looks like a RGB LED will draw about 0.09 watts and a green LED about 0.06 watts. This may not be correct for the exact components they have used and I may have misinterpreted forward current as I am not an electrical engineer (although I did study some electronics a long time ago).
Our gen 1 batteries have one RGB status LED and four green SOC LEDs. That infers the LEDs for each battery will use around a third of a watt. Our gen 1 inverter has 16 grid/solar/demand/battery flow LEDs and one "lightning bolt" shaped status light. Assuming that the status light actually uses two LEDs or a larger single LED of equivalent wattage to two single LEDs that gives an assumed draw of circa 1.62 watts.
I recently had a battery drop off the system and needed to call GivEnergy support to get it back online (thankfully I noticed quite quickly). As part of that call I was asked questions about the state of the lights on each battery.
The obvious problem is that if all of the lights are off then they cannot contribute towards such fault finding. The battery did not initially come back online after restarting it, so it's perfectly possible that there would be no way for a user to reliably re-enable the lights in the event of a fault to aid such fault finding.
If the fault is a communication issue then it obviously wouldn't be possible to re-enable the lights via the app or portal, so at the minimum they would need to default to on after a restart until explicitly switched off again. Restarting a battery is relatively simple (as long as it is willing to play along) but I believe restarting an inverter means isolating from AC, DC and panels and waiting a period of time for residual power in the system to die away, before carefully reconnecting everything in the correct order. Getting the order wrong can, I believe, cause damage.
This seems like an awful lot of work (and potential risk) to go to in order to save at best maybe 2.5 watts for a two battery system.
